## Phoenix's Best Live Music Venues
Beat Map shares insider knowledge on the Valley's top concert venues:
- **Crescent Ballroom**: Perfect for intimate performances where you can feel the artist's energy
- **The Rebel Lounge**: Phoenix's punk rock headquarters and dive bar extraordinaire
- **The Van Buren**: Premier mid-sized venue hosting national touring acts
- **Venue Phoenix**: Large-scale productions and epic stage setups
